Apple Cookies
3 apples, cored
1 cup walnuts
1/4 cup raw honey or agave
1/2 teaspoon Cinnamon
1/2 cup dried coconut
Blend/Process everything till combined. Either form into balls with your hands or use an ice cream scoop to drop cookies directly onto teflex sheet. I love using an ice cream scoop for raw and non-raw cookies alike. They make everything uniform and are so super easy to use. Dehydrate cookies for about 10-12 hours until solid on the outside but still chewy inside. ENJOY 🙂
